SUPERIOR OIL COMPANY v. KING

No. 37840.

324 P.2d 847 (1958)

SUPERIOR OIL COMPANY, a corporation, Plaintiff in Error, v. Lester KING, Defendant in Error.

Supreme Court of Oklahoma.

April 23, 1958.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Dyer & Dyer, Ardmore, for plaintiff in error.

Williams, Williams & Williams, Ardmore, for defendant in error.


HALLEY, J.

Lester King filed this action in the District Court of Marshall County against Superior Oil Company and Sun Oil Company, seeking damages for the destruction of a water well by a seismograph shot by defendants, and for exemplary damages for trespassing upon his farm and destroying his water well that had produced water for domestic use for forty years.
